Does Stevia come from ragweed?

Allergy to ragweed and related plants: Stevia is in the Asteraceae/Compositae plant family. This includes ragweed and many other plants, including chrysanthemums , marigolds , daisies, daisies, and many others. The theory is that people sensitive to ragweed or related plants could also be sensitive to Stevia.

Keep this in mind, how common is Stevia allergy.

A 2015 review found that there have been very few cases of stevia allergy. The FDA and the European Commission both concluded that there are very few people who are allergic to stevia.
